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to enhance insulation and protection. These services typically include measuring,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ely installing them to ensure a proper fit. The process often requires precise adjustments to ensure the storm windows operate smoothly and provide an effective barrier against drafts, moisture, and debris. Professional installers focus on ensuring that the storm windows are properly sealed, which helps improve overall energy efficiency and window performance.
One of the primary problems storm window installation addresses is air leakage around existing windows. Gaps and cracks in older or poorly sealed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s, as well as drafts that affect indoor comfort. Storm windows act as an additional barrier, reducing heat transfer and preventing drafts from penetrating indoor spaces. They also help protect the original window panes from weather-related damage, such as hail or heavy rain, extending the lifespan of the existing windows and reducing maintenance needs.
Properties that commonly benefit from storm window installation include historic homes, residential houses, and multi-family buildings. These types of properties often have older windows that may lack modern insulation features, making storm windows an effective solution for improving energy efficiency without replacing the entire window system. Commercial buildings and rental properties can also utilize storm windows to maintain consistent indoor temperatures and protect against weather elements, especially in regions with harsh winters or frequent storms.

Material Costs - The cost of storm window materials typ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on size and quality. Larger or custom-sized storm windows may increase exp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Installation Fees - Installation costs generally fall between $100 and $300 per window, with variations based on complexity and location. Some projects may involve additional labor charges for prep work or removal of old windows.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for storm window installation can range from $150 to $450 per window, combining material and labor costs. Larger or multiple-window projects may offer volume estimates from local service providers.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s might include frame repairs or modifications, which can add $50 to $200 per window. It is advisable to contact local specialists for detailed quotes tailored to specific properties in Weaverville, NC.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
